Jackson family gathers to mourn death

26 June 2009 @ 07:36 pm ET

Hours after the news of the king of pop's death was revealed on Thursday afternoon, the families of Michael Jackson gathered at the home of his parents, Joe and Katherine Jackson to mourn his death, in nearby Encino, California.

On Friday morning, his sister, Janet Jackson, a musical star in her own right, was seen arriving at Van Nuys airport near Los Angeles, reportedly on her way to join her family.

"Janet Jackson is grief-stricken and devastated at the sudden loss of her brother," her manager Kenneth Crear said in a statement.

Many of Michael's family including Sister LaToya and Brother Jermaine gathered at the UCLA Medical Center on Thursday afternoon after the self-titled “King of Pop” was transported via ambulance from his Holmby Hills home in Los Angeles.

Michael Jackson is survived by siblings Rebbie, Jackie, Tito, Jermaine, La Toya, Marlon, Randy and Janet – along with his parents Joseph Walter “Joe” and Katherine Esther.

He also has three children — Prince Michael Jackson, 12; Paris Michael Katherine Jackson, 11; and Prince Michael Jackson II, 7.

Jackson was born in Gary, Indiana on August 29, 1958, the seventh of nine children and has been entertaining audiences nearly his entire life.

He lived as a virtual recluse since his acquittal in 2005 on charges of child molestation.
